Free Plan Limits

Clockify offers unlimited free users; Toggl strictly limits teams to five people for free.

Clockify

Clockify provides the same core tracking functionality for unlimited users forever. This makes Clockify the clear winner for quickly growing startup teams. You only pay Clockify when you need advanced administrative features. Clockify's free plan includes the Timer, Timesheet, Kiosk, and basic Reports. You get billable rates without spending a single dollar. This generosity fuels widespread adoption and makes scaling simple. Toggl’s free plan is excellent but caps the team size at five users. If your sixth employee joins, you must automatically upgrade to Toggl's Starter plan at $9 per user. For teams anticipating rapid growth or needing highly affordable tracking beyond five people, Clockify is the definitive choice.

Workforce Management

Clockify includes integrated HR tools like Scheduling and Time Off; Toggl requires external services.

Clockify

Clockify offers a comprehensive workforce management suite starting with the STANDARD plan. Features include Time Off management, attendance tracking, and overtime calculation. PRO users gain access to Scheduling and resource forecasting tools, keeping everything in one place. Toggl focuses predominantly on time tracking metrics and deep financial reporting. It lacks these core internal HR management features like scheduling specific shifts or managing employee time off. If you are tracking time for internal payroll, compliance, or managing rotating shifts, Clockify is essential. Toggl requires you to handle these processes manually or use another application entirely. Clockify centralizes administrative control, simplifying life for HR and operations managers needing integrated visibility.

Billing and Invoicing

Clockify allows direct invoicing creation; Toggl requires Starter plan features for basic billing rate management.

Clockify

Clockify streamlines billing by allowing you to generate professional invoices directly from billable hours. This feature is unlocked at the STANDARD tier ($5.49/month). Clockify also includes features like expense tracking and locking approved time entries to ensure finance data integrity. This makes the billing workflow seamless and reliable before client delivery. Toggl’s Starter plan ($9/month) includes billable rates and team-level revenue reports. However, Toggl does not explicitly list direct invoice generation from tracked time. If generating client invoices accurately and quickly is a primary goal, Clockify’s integrated suite offers greater utility and specific features earlier.

Advanced Security

Clockify offers data region selection; both offer Single Sign-On, but Clockify adds audit logs and custom domains.

Clockify

Clockify’s PRO plan allows large organizations to select their data region (EU, UK, USA, AUS). This is critical for regulatory and compliance requirements. Clockify ENTERPRISE also includes control accounts and a comprehensive audit log. This provides managers with complete oversight and tamper-proof security records. Toggl includes Single Sign-On (SSO) starting at the Premium tier ($18/month). This meets a key security requirement for larger teams seeking centralization. Clockify generally provides more comprehensive security and control features suitable for highly regulated or large global enterprises.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is cheaper: Clockify or Toggl?

Clockify is definitively cheaper and scales better than Toggl. Clockify offers a permanent free plan for unlimited users. Toggl’s free plan is capped at five users, requiring a paid upgrade immediately once you cross that threshold.

Does Toggl have scheduling and time off management like Clockify?

No, Toggl focuses on core time tracking and analytical reports. Clockify is better if you require integrated workforce management solutions. Clockify offers features like Time Off, Attendance, Overtime, and Scheduling on paid plans.

Which software has better customer support?

Clockify is the clear winner for customer support. Clockify guarantees responsive 24/7 human support. Toggl users repeatedly report non-responsive support and ignoring crucial billing inquiries.

Is Clockify better for invoicing clients?

Yes, Clockify offers integrated invoicing features and a direct QuickBooks integration on its STANDARD plan. This functionality is not readily available or explicitly listed in Toggl’s core feature set.

Can I use Clockify to track time from a shared computer?

Yes, Clockify includes a dedicated Kiosk function. This allows employees to clock in and out from a single, shared device in the office. Toggl does not offer a specific Kiosk feature.

Which tool is better for deep financial analysis and customization reports?

Toggl is designed for deep financial analysis. Its Premium plan offers fully customizable and flexible reporting options. While Clockify reports are robust, Toggl allows for greater strategic business intelligence configuration.
